titleOfInvention Method for producing spherical fine powder of amorphous nylon resin
abstract (57) [Summary] [Purpose] Amorphous nylon fine spherical particles are produced by the dissolution method. [Structure] Amorphous nylon pellets are heated and dissolved in a mixed solvent of ethylene glycol and morpholine or dimethylacetamide, and the solution is cooled from the upper layer to prevent formation of a nylon resin film on the bottom of the tank and to efficiently form particles. Is generated.
